Wrong. Life is lived somewhere in between.</b><br><br>Duchess Day Radley is a thirteen-year-old self-proclaimed outlaw. Rules are for other people. She is the fierce protector of her five-year-old brother, Robin, and the parent to her mother, Star, a single mom incapable of taking care of herself, let alone her two kids.<br><br>Walk has never left the coastal California town where he and Star grew
